Robotic Hoovers

Ideally, robot vacuums should complement your hand-driven, standard vacuum cleaner and be used for daily or weekly touch-ups. Many owners have reported that their floors appear and feel better after regular use.

Look for mapping capabilities, which enable the robot to remember your home and navigate efficiently. Other features include spot/zone cleaning, recharge and resume as well as advanced navigation and object recognition.

Robotic cleaners require maintenance just like any other machine. Regular cleaning of filters, brushes and sensors helps to prevent clogs and optimize performance. Also, you should empty the bin regularly to keep it from overflowing and also wash and dry the pads (if your model uses pads that are reusable) between use. In addition the battery must be recharged periodically and you may have to replace it on a more frequent basis if you are using your robot for sweeping or mopping frequently.
